Output 342808118207cfa175ced9e53ca346c134a13353ce5520b4b6455d6b4a160ae1:38

value
42760840
script pubkey
OP_0 OP_PUSHBYTES_20 e9194f98e65e94ef0d46bc77d60c17a15929230f
address
bc1qayv5lx8xt62w7r2xh3mavrqh59vjjgc09g0zd3
transaction
342808118207cfa175ced9e53ca346c134a13353ce5520b4b6455d6b4a160ae1
spent
true